We are social beings which means we innately desire a sense of connectedness with others.  However, there are many challenges that impede these connections including busy lives, inhibitions, and the recent pandemic that forced many of us into isolation.   We are also hard-wired to avoid stressful situations, so often we avoid any opportunity that takes us out of our comfort zones. Therefore, many of us must examine the way we think about ourselves and how we connect with others. In this talk we will explore this phenomenon and consider solutions to these and other social challenges.  Led by Lizzie Linn Casanave who has taught classes on the science of happiness.  Her Ph.D. studies at UMass Lowell focus on well-being and emotional intelligence in the higher ed. classroom.
